Even with only <strong>24 hours in Vienna<\/strong>, there\u2019s still plenty of time to tour the most iconic landmarks of the imperial city.\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"a-brief-history-of-vienna\">A brief history of Vienna<\/h2>\n\n\n<p>Vienna was home to one of the most formative dynasties in the entire world. The city\u2019s origins date back all the way to Rome when the military encampment, Vindobona, was stationed in the modern-day center of Vienna. Then, <strong>the Habsburg dynasty<\/strong>, one of the greatest dynasties to ever exist in Europe, reigned from the 11th to the 18th century.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The dynasty held power during the <strong>Renaissance in Vienna<\/strong>, which made it the birthplace of many classical art movements. The dynasty continued until WWI when Emperor Charles I abdicated the throne. For intrepid travelers only spending 24 hours in Vienna, we\u2019ve put together a comprehensive guide of Vienna\u2019s greatest hits, so you won&#8217;t miss out on some of the most amazing sights in all of Europe.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"how-to-travel-around-viennanbsp\">How to travel around Vienna <\/h2>\n\n\n<p>Even with only 24 hours in Vienna, the city\u2019s efficient design means it\u2019s not difficult to navigate. Not to mention, Vienna has a world-class transportation system known as the <strong>Wiener Linien<\/strong>, with five underground lines, 29 trams, and 90 bus lines.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Tons of safe bike lanes make Vienna a very walkable and bike-friendly city and tourists can easily rent a CityBike to visit all of the city\u2019s top hits. Although the general area of St. Stephen\u2019s won\u2019t cost you a penny to enter (making it one of the best free things to do in Vienna!), this <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/en\/vienna-attractions-c60335\/tickets-for-st-stephen-s-cathedral-dom-museum-wien-audio-guides-p982496\/?partner=tiqetsblog&amp;tq_campaign=ViennaTTDLink\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">St. Stephen\u2019s ticket<\/a> includes an audio guide and entrance to St. Stephen\u2019s, the Dom Museum Wien, the South and North Towers, and the catacombs.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div data-tiqets-widget=\"discovery\" data-cards-layout=\"horizontal\" data-content-type=\"product\" data-content-ids=\"982496\" data-partner=\"tiqetsblog\" data-tq-campaign=\"ViennaTTD\"><\/div><script defer=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/widgets.tiqets.com\/loader.js\"><\/script>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"wander-hofburg-palacenbsp\"><strong>Wander Hofburg Palace <\/strong><\/h3>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full is-resized\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/sereina-Ejxe9k6_ie8-unsplash.jpg\" alt=\"The statue of Archduke Charles outside Hofburg Palace\" class=\"wp-image-214763\" style=\"width:1000px;height:667px\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Photo by&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/unsplash.com\/@seri_lia?utm_source=unsplash&amp;utm_medium=referral&amp;utm_content=creditCopyText\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Sereina<\/a>&nbsp;on&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/unsplash.com\/s\/photos\/the-hofburg-palace?utm_source=unsplash&amp;utm_medium=referral&amp;utm_content=creditCopyText\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Unsplash<\/a><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p>A 15-minute walk from St. Stephen\u2019s is where you\u2019ll find the imperial seat of the Habsburg Dynasty, <strong>The Hofburg Palace<\/strong>. Vienna is well known for its opulent palaces, and Hofburg does not disappoint. Serving as the prime residence for Empress Maria Theresa and Emperor Franz II, this luxurious palace is home to 18 buildings and 2600 rooms. Every ruler since 1275 has added rooms and additions to the Hofburg Palace.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Within the Hofburg Palace are some very famous attractions, including the <strong>Austrian National Library<\/strong>, the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/en\/spanish-riding-school-tickets-l145873\/?partner=tiqetsblog&amp;tq_campaign=ViennaTTDLink\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><strong>Spanish Riding School<\/strong><\/a>, the <strong>National History Museum,<\/strong> and the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/en\/the-hofburg-tickets-l173697\/?partner=tiqetsblog&amp;tq_campaign=ViennaTTDLink\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><strong>Sisi Museum<\/strong><\/a><strong>.&nbsp;<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<div data-tiqets-widget=\"discovery\" data-cards-layout=\"horizontal\" data-content-type=\"product\" data-content-ids=\"1007575,974585\" data-partner=\"tiqetsblog\" data-tq-campaign=\"ViennaTTD\"><\/div><script defer=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/widgets.tiqets.com\/loader.js\"><\/script>\n\n\n\n<p>Looking for more free things to do in Vienna? A little culture and knowledge never hurt anybody, so check out this list of the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/en\/vienna-attractions-c60335\/museums-galleries-t442\/\">top museums in Vienna<\/a>.&nbsp;&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"mariatheresienplatz\"><strong>Maria-Theresien-Platz<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full is-resized\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/yousef-espanioly-8PtpVCy0Iuk-unsplash.jpg\" alt=\"outside Maria Theresien Platz during the day\" class=\"wp-image-214758\" style=\"width:1000px\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Photo by&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/unsplash.com\/@yespanioly?utm_source=unsplash&amp;utm_medium=referral&amp;utm_content=creditCopyText\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Yousef Espanioly<\/a>&nbsp;on&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/unsplash.com\/s\/photos\/maria-theresien-platz?utm_source=unsplash&amp;utm_medium=referral&amp;utm_content=creditCopyText\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Unsplash<\/a><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p>You cannot visit Vienna without taking in the beauty of the large public square, <strong>Maria-Theresien-Platz<\/strong>. Another hot spot for travelers that\u2019s one of the best free things to do in Vienna, this square was built in honor of Maria Theresa, the Habsburg Empress. One of the most famous Habsburgs, Maria bore 16 children and was known for reforming the school system.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Her 19-meter-high statue stands in the center of the square with two museums on either side, the <strong>Naturhistorisches Museum<\/strong> (Natural History Museum) and the <strong>Kunsthistorisches Museum<\/strong> (Art History Museum). It can be quite hard to tell the two buildings apart since they\u2019re practically identical.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"kunsthistorisches-museum-wien\"><strong>Kunsthistorisches Museum Wien<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/shutterstock_614230595.jpg\" alt=\"Kunsthistorisches Museum Wien\" class=\"wp-image-221228\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Photo by <a href=\"https:\/\/www.shutterstock.com\/g\/Timelynx\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Timelynx<\/a> on Shutterstock <\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p>This <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/en\/vienna-attractions-c60335\/tickets-for-kunsthistorisches-museum-wien-skip-the-line-p974058\/?partner=tiqetsblog&amp;tq_campaign=ViennaTTDLink\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">skip-the-line ticket<\/a> grants you access to the <strong>Kunsthistorisches Museum<\/strong> and some of its temporary exhibitions. The owners claim their schnitzel is \u2018a schnitzel to fear,\u2019 so make sure you don\u2019t miss out on this authentic Viennese experience.<\/p>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"admire-the-schonbrunn-palace-and-gardens\"><strong>Admire the Sch\u00f6nbrunn Palace and Gardens<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/shutterstock_153644612.jpg\" alt=\"the opulent Sch\u00f6nbrunn Palace.\" class=\"wp-image-221229\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Photo by <a href=\"https:\/\/www.shutterstock.com\/g\/mrssippy\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Pani Garmyder<\/a> on Shutterstock<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p>About a half an hour tram ride from Schnitzelwirt is the opulent <strong>Sch\u00f6nbrunn Palace<\/strong>. The palace\u2019s glittering indoor and outdoor exterior shows it is the true encapsulation of imperial heritage. The palace was originally designed as an imperial hunting lodge for <strong>Crown Prince Joseph<\/strong> by the Baroque architect Johann <strong>Bernhard Fischer von Erlach<\/strong>. It later became the summer residence of Maria Theresa. You can easily spend the whole afternoon at <strong>Sch\u00f6nbrunn Palace<\/strong>, so carve out a few hours to see this beautiful Vienna landmark.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div data-tiqets-widget=\"discovery\" data-cards-layout=\"horizontal\" data-content-type=\"product\" data-content-ids=\"976203\" data-partner=\"tiqetsblog\" data-tq-campaign=\"ViennaTTD\"><\/div><script defer=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/widgets.tiqets.com\/loader.js\"><\/script>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"explore-the-tiergarten-schonbrunn\"><strong>Explore the Tiergarten Sch\u00f6nbrunn<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/shutterstock_1852922158.jpg\" alt=\"Tiergarten Sch\u00f6nbrunn \" class=\"wp-image-221230\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Photo by <a href=\"https:\/\/www.shutterstock.com\/g\/Pyty\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Pyty<\/a> on Shutterstock<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p>If you can make the time, consider visiting the world\u2019s oldest zoo, the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/en\/vienna-attractions-c60335\/tickets-for-tiergarten-schonbrunn-zoo-vienna-skip-the-line-p974071\/?partner=tiqetsblog&amp;tq_campaign=ViennaTTDLink\"><strong>Tiergarten Sch\u00f6nbrunn<\/strong><\/a><strong>,<\/strong> founded in 1752 by the Holy Roman Emperor, Francis I. The zoo is located in <strong>Sch\u00f6nbrunn park<\/strong> and is currently home to over 700 different animal species.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The zoo homes giant pandas, polar bears, elephants, and even lions! The market\u2019s classed as one of the more unusual things to do in Vienna, so be sure to stock up on local delicacies and sample some of Austria\u2019s best wine and cheese.<\/p>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"check-out-the-belvedere-palacenbsp\"><strong>Check out the Belvedere Palace<\/strong> <\/h3>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/shutterstock_172220219.jpg\" alt=\"Check out the belvedere palace with only 24 hours in Vienna\" class=\"wp-image-221231\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Photo by <a href=\"https:\/\/www.shutterstock.com\/g\/jlrphoto\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">canadastock<\/a> on Shutterstock<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p>Before going into your perfect evening in Vienna, try to carve out some time to witness the stunning <strong>Belvedere Palace, <\/strong>which is about a 20-minute train ride from the Naschmarkt. In the 18th century, Prince Eugene of Savoy commissioned world-renowned architect Johann Lukas von Hildebrandt to build a Baroque palace as a Summer residence. The<strong> Lower Belvedere <\/strong>was completed in 1716, and the<strong> Upper Belvedere, <\/strong>which sits on higher ground, was completed in 1724. After Prince Eugene\u2019s death, Empress Maria Theresa exhibited the imperial collections in the Upper Belvedere, making it one of the first public museums in the world.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Today, many of the rooms are still home to beautiful art pieces, including <strong>Gustav Klimt&#8217;s famous work, The Kiss.<\/strong> Grab this <a href=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/en\/vienna-attractions-c60335\/tickets-for-belvedere-palace-p974613\/?partner=tiqetsblog&amp;tq_campaign=ViennaTTDLink\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">skip-the-line ticket<\/a> to the Upper Belvedere to see fantastic works by Gustav Klimt and Van Gogh.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"the-museum-of-contemporary-art-belvedere-21\"><strong>The Museum of Contemporary Art: Belvedere 21<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full is-resized\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tiqets.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/c48321f5efd444d3829869dd1f080415-1.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-214767\" style=\"width:1000px;height:667px\"\/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p>If you prefer modern art, head to one of the <strong>top museums in Vienna<\/strong>, Belvedere 21, the Museum of Contemporary Art.
